Requesting a ride in advance

Requesting an Uber ride in advance can be a convenient option when catching an Uber at the airport. Here are some key points to keep in mind:

Uber Reserve:

Uber Reserve is a feature that allows you to schedule your ride in advance. You can request a ride up to 90 days ahead of time, which can be especially useful when planning airport trips. This feature is available at select major airports worldwide, including more than 50 major airports in the US and some international airports in Europe and Africa.

How to Request:

To request an Uber ride in advance using Uber Reserve, follow these steps:

  • Open the Uber app and tap the "Reserve" icon.
  • Choose the date and time of your ride. You can schedule it up to 90 days in advance.
  • Select your ride option and vehicle type. The availability of certain ride options may vary depending on your location.
  • Confirm your pickup location at the airport.
  • Review the reservation details, including the estimated price, which includes a reservation fee.
  • Keep an eye on your app for updates regarding your assigned driver and trip details.

Wait Times and Fees:

It's important to note that different ride options have different grace periods for wait times. For UberX, Uber Comfort, and UberXL, the driver will typically wait for up to 2 minutes before applying wait-time fees. For premium options like Uber Black, Uber Black SUV, Uber Premier, and Uber Premier SUV, you'll have a 5-minute grace period.

Additionally, Uber Reserve provides a waiting time of up to one hour after your flight's estimated arrival time for free. After that, the driver can cancel the trip, and you will be charged the total fare. You can avoid wait-time fees by providing accurate flight details and arrival gate information.

Cancellation Policy:

With Uber Reserve, you can cancel your ride reservation at no charge up to a certain time before your scheduled pickup. This grace period is typically between one hour and 60 minutes. After that, you may be charged a cancellation fee.

Pick-up locations

When you request a ride, the app will direct you to a designated pick-up location, which may differ from where you would usually meet friends and family. Airports are busy places, so it's important to follow the directions in the app to find your driver. You can also use the app to call or text your driver if you need to.

If you're at a busy event or location with multiple entrances and exits, like an airport, you will be asked to select a specific location to meet your driver. The app will suggest convenient pick-up locations and flag restricted or illegal pick-up spots, so you can make an informed decision when setting your pick-up spot. You can also move the pin on the map to choose a different location from the one suggested.

It's good practice to collect your luggage from baggage claim and be ready to step outside before requesting pick-up. Many airports have specific requirements about where riders can be picked up, so your app will confirm the designated pick-up location(s) when you're required to meet your driver at a specific area or level of the airport.

Some airports, like Boston Logan International Airport, have designated areas for app-based ride services. Passengers should follow the signs for Ride App/Uber/Lyft from the terminals and can only be picked up in these designated areas.

Avoiding wait-time fees

When catching an Uber at the airport, you can avoid wait-time fees by following these steps:

Firstly, it is important to request your ride only when you are ready to be picked up. This means that you should have already de-boarded the plane, cleared customs (if necessary), and collected your luggage. Requesting a ride at the correct time is essential to avoiding wait-time fees, as these fees are charged to compensate drivers for the time they spend waiting for riders.

Secondly, ensure that you have selected the correct arrivals gate and follow the instructions provided in the app to locate your driver. The app will guide you to a designated pickup location, and you can also use the app to call or text your driver if needed.

Thirdly, be mindful of the grace period for your specific ride option. For UberX, Uber Comfort, and UberXL rides, you must meet your driver within 2 minutes of their arrival to avoid wait-time fees. For Uber Black, Uber Black SUV, Uber Premier, and Uber Premier SUV rides, you have a 5-minute grace period. If you are unable to locate your driver within these time frames, you may incur wait-time fees, which are charged on a per-minute basis.

Additionally, if you are using the Uber Reserve service, you should be aware that there is a waiting time of up to one hour after your flight's estimated arrival time. If you do not meet your driver within this time frame, the driver can cancel the trip request, and you will be charged the total fare.

By following these steps and being mindful of the timing and grace periods, you can effectively avoid incurring wait-time fees when catching an Uber at the airport.

Finding the correct driver

When catching an Uber at the airport, there are several steps you can take to ensure that you find the correct driver. Firstly, it is important to note that airport pickups are very different from pickups anywhere else, and specific requirements are in place.

To begin, you can schedule a ride up to 90 days in advance, which can help reduce travel stress. You can also request a ride on-demand, but it is recommended to do so only after you have deplaned, cleared customs (if necessary), and collected your luggage. When scheduling or requesting a ride, you may be asked to select a specific location or terminal to be picked up from, as airports often have designated pickup points.

Once your ride request has been accepted, you will receive the driver's details, including their name, photo, car color and model, and license plate number. This information will help you identify your driver and their vehicle when they arrive. If you are unsure, you can always ask the driver if they are there for "Cheryl", for example, or confirm your name with them.

Additionally, you can use the Uber app to contact your driver directly. This can be done through calling, texting, or using the pre-written messages available in the app. These features will help you coordinate with your driver and ensure that you have found the correct person.

Car seat requirements

Car seats are a necessity when travelling with children, and ridesharing apps like Uber have made it possible to request rides with car seats. Uber Car Seat is available in select cities, including New York, Los Angeles, Orlando, San Francisco, Miami, Washington, D.C., and Atlanta. In these cities, Uber has partnered with Nuna to provide quality and stylish car seats for children.

When requesting an Uber Car Seat ride, open the Uber app and set your pickup and drop-off locations. Scroll through the list of available vehicle types and select "Car Seat." A surcharge, typically around $10, will be applied to your total price. It is important to note that Uber Car Seat rides are currently equipped with only one car seat per car, which can be a challenge if travelling with multiple children.

If Uber Car Seat is not available in your city, you will need to bring your own car seat and install it yourself. This is the only safe and legal option when travelling with a child in an Uber. Drivers are not responsible for providing or installing car seats, and they may cancel the trip if you do not have the required car seat.

When bringing your own car seat, it is recommended to send a message to the driver immediately after matching to let them know that you will need to install a car seat. This ensures that the driver is aware and can accommodate your needs. It is also essential to follow local car seat laws and ensure that your child meets the height and weight requirements for the car seat.
